ALONSO-FERNANDEZ, Francisco. Personal history of the nun Theresa of Jesus. Salud Ment [online]. 2013, vol.36, n.5, pp.361-366. ISSN 0185-3325.

This book is classified according to the topic and the method respectively as "mysticism and psychopathology" and as "psychohistory" or "personal history". Nobody knew until the twentieth century that the Saint nun Theresa of Jesus came from a jewish family. She was a little and young girl terrified by hell and the Inquisition and mortified by a serious depressive disorder associated with hysterical comorbidity of psychomotor type. At he age of 40, our nun became the Spanish mystic number one: a mysticism of passion illustrated with experiences in form of hallucinated fantasies. Her Christian existential development was very influenced by these factors: the disparity between her parents, the self-repression of her Hebrew lineage, her cyclothymic temperament and a strong erotic tendency.
